GE Vernova Competitiveness Intern, Heavy Duty Gas Turbine Product Management - Summer 2026

GE Vernova is committed to leading the energy transition and is seeking a Competitiveness Intern for the summer of 2026. The intern will contribute to the product management team by providing data-driven analyses and insights into markets, competitors, and products to support strategic planning and marketing strategies.

Responsibilities

Develop and maintain an integrated view of competitiveness of GEV Gas Power new unit and services offerings vs. other OEMs and Independent Service Providers (ISPs)
Collaborate with the product managers and fleet owners to provide a differentiated and compelling value proposition when facing select competitor offerings
Support competitor simulation (red team blue team) events on specific deals or key technology areas to improve our competitive position
Conduct quarterly win/loss review, post-mortems, and win/loss statistical data analysis/segmentation to drive actions to improve competitiveness
Supply chain competitive analysis for new units and services
Decarbonization H2 competitor capability assessment
Customer sustainability strategy assessment update
Playbooks and sell-against content for competitive situations
Competitive strategy scenario simulation event
